Planning to hike a creek in a slot canyon? Attempting to photograph while you snorkel? Hoping to use your phone to its fullest despite inclement weather?
The E-Case Waterproof iPhone Case allows you to do all of that — and more. This Seattle-made product gives you full usage of your mobile device, from using apps to taking photos, and even the use of speakers and microphone, despite being sheltered from the elements in a sturdy case.
The case is designed like a folder, so it’s not limited to a specific iPhone edition — you won’t have to buy a new case every time you upgrade your phone.
Each case is individually tested in one meter of water for 30 minutes. The Ziplock-type closure system is fairly easy to manage, just double-check you’ve sealed it before dunking it in water. The case is also PVC-free, meaning it is designed for ultimate cold weather pliability; the case won’t stiffen when the temperature drops. The windows on the case are also UV-resistant.
The E-Case features “lash points” at either end so you can fashion straps or hooks to secure it to your clothing or gear.
What’s truly great about this item is that you need not worry about locking your phone away in an unwieldy case. Just slip the entire thing — case and all — into this “folder” for the times when you want extra protection for your phone.
The product comes in black, Midnight Blue, Cool Gray, Olive, Mandarin Red and Cosmic Purple. E-Case also sells an array of similar products for other items, like iPods, iPads, e-readers, tablets and more. There’s also a line of multipurpose cases for use with whatever else you need to protect: keys, wallets, cameras, game systems and other mobile devices.
